You can set Traffic Control permissions in TD Console if you have the policy-based permissions feature. If you don't, all users in the account automatically have full access, allowing them to use Traffic Control.
- Log into TD Console.
- Navigate to Control Panel > Security > Policies.

- Select a policy or create a new policy, and then select Permissions.

- Scroll down to the Audience Studio section.
| Options | Description |
|---|---|
| Full Access | Users can view Audience Studio's features, including profiles, segment folders, predictive scoring, API tokens, and journeys. Full access to Audience Studio permissions is required to enable Traffic Control permissions.![]() |
| Limited Access | With Limited Access, you must also select the parent segments that contain the journeys you want to include in Traffic Control priority groups. Select Add to include each parent segment for this policy-based permission. Select the pencil icon to make permission updates for segment folders in each parent segment.![]() |

| Options | Description |
|---|---|
| None | Users cannot see the Traffic Control feature. |
| View Access | Users can view priority groups and capping; editing is not allowed. |
| Full Access | Users can create, edit, and delete objects in Traffic Control. |
